Uncovering the Secrets of Antarctica: What the Melting Continent Means for Our Planet

From afar, Antarctica appears as a vast white sheet, surrounded by dark ocean waters. But up close, it reveals a complex web of ice, ocean currents, and marine life. This delicate balance is now in serious danger. A recent study highlights alarming changes happening in Antarctica. These shifts could push the continent past a critical point, risking severe sea-level rise and flooding in coastal cities around the world.

Climate scientist Nerilie Abram, who led the study, says, “Changes in one part of the system affect others. This isn’t just about Antarctica; it has global consequences.” Abrupt changes, like the rapid loss of sea ice, happen quicker than scientists expect. For instance, ice shelves can collapse in just days, while ice sheets can take centuries to respond. Unfortunately, less sea ice leads to more warming, creating a cycle that’s hard to stop.

One major reason for these changes is the loss of summer sea ice. In 2014, sea ice coverage reached its highest point in recorded history. Since then, it has decreased significantly, retreating an average of 75 miles toward the coast. During winter, sea ice around Antarctica has declined four times faster than in the Arctic over the past decade.

Researcher Ryan Fogt notes, “Antarctica is changing at a rate we previously thought was limited to the Arctic.” This rapid decline raises concerns among scientists about a possible tipping point in the region. Zachary M. Labe, another climate expert, remarks that we may be entering a phase of dramatic sea ice loss in Antarctica.

Warming waters from nearby oceans are now threatening the vast ice sheets and their supporting ice shelves. The ice shelves work like walls, holding back the ice on land. When they melt, the ice behind them can flow more quickly into the sea, contributing to rising sea levels. Matthew England, an oceanographer, warns that significant temperature increases could lead to a collapse of parts of the West Antarctic Ice Sheet, raising sea levels by over 10 feet.

Additionally, as sea ice disappears, the Antarctic Overturning Circulation—an essential ocean system—may slow down. This process normally helps circulate cold, salty water that sinks and enriches marine nutrients. Without it, the entire ocean ecosystem could face severe challenges.

Even iconic species such as emperor penguins are at risk. These penguins rely on stable sea ice for breeding. As the ice disappears before the chicks mature, entire colonies face disastrous breeding failures. “We’re witnessing catastrophic breeding events all around Antarctica,” Abram explains.

Overall, Antarctica’s warming is not just a passing issue; it’s a persistent crisis. Extreme weather events, like the unprecedented heat wave in East Antarctica in 2022, can push vulnerable areas beyond recovery. Climatologist Fogt emphasizes that such extreme events can expose weaknesses in the ecosystem, making recovery nearly impossible.

The bright side? Researchers are gaining valuable insights into how Antarctica reacts to climate change, improving prediction models for the future. Yet, urgent action is needed. To mitigate catastrophic changes, experts advocate for significant cuts to greenhouse gas emissions. Every small effort to limit warming makes a difference in avoiding devastating outcomes. “Sea-level rise can spark global instability far worse than what we’re currently experiencing,” England warns.
